Tea tree oil, derived from the leaves of the Melaleuca alternifolia plant, is one of the most researched natural oils when it comes to skin health. Its antifungal properties are particularly effective in treating skin conditions like athlete’s foot and nail fungus. Studies have shown that applying tea tree oil can reduce the severity of these issues, and regular use may help prevent their recurrence. It’s believed that the oil works by penetrating the fungal cell walls and disrupting their structure, thus inhibiting their growth.

It is, however, important to note that while natural oils can be beneficial, they should be used correctly. Dilution with a carrier oil—as opposed to using them undiluted—is often recommended to prevent skin irritation.
Furthermore, it’s essential to choose high-quality oils from reputable sources to ensure their effectiveness. The purity of natural oils can significantly affect their performance in treating and preventing health issues. Many commercially available oils contain fillers or are diluted, which can reduce their efficacy.
